Meaning of "pueblo indians"
Pueblo Indians refers to a Native American tribe or group of indigenous people who traditionally inhabited the southwestern region of the United States, particularly in the area now known as New Mexico and Arizona. It implies a specific cultural and historical context related to the Pueblo Native Americans
